
Urijah Faber lost his title in late 2008, but he's back with a vengeance and ready to take what he says is his. "No way, Jose" has been his rallying cry as he preps to enter the cage against current titleholder Jose Aldo, but before the pugilists go at it, the California Kid took some time out to answer some of our burning questions.
Do you have a favorite position to dominate an opponent?
It depends on the opponent, but I try to find an opponent's least comfortable position. Sometimes it's standing or on the ground, but a lot of finishes are with chokes, rear naked chokes, front chokes and the like. Things like that would be my go-to moves.

What is your favorite food to bulk up after weighing in?
After the WEC 48 weigh-ins, I had Thai food, chicken and vegetables with rice. I also had some coconut, like straight out of the coconut. I had an AMP Energy drink and a Powerbar. I'm going to have dinner after that.
What was your parents' reaction to fighting in MMA?
My mom used to really not like it at all. She has come to grips with it, it's been 7 years now. I was an adult when I had started and there was nothing she could do to stop me. She has been supportive. My dad has been there for all of my fights and he loves it. My stepdad has sided with my mom, so they have not been to a fight yet. They watch it afterwards and they know what happens, so they don't have to freak out the whole time.
